Thanks for wishing to get involved in KDE development!

We have the "junior-jobs" keyword in Bugzilla, which is a good place to start: 
https://bugs.kde.org/buglist.cgi?bug_status=UNCONFIRMED&bug_status=CONFIRMED&bug_status=ASSIGNED&bug_status=REOPENED&keywords=junior-jobs%2C%20&keywords_type=allwords&list_id=1560073&query_format=advanced

The "usability" keyword is also a good option to look at, as a number of them 
are small jobs.

Feel free to respond back with any projects that catch your eye, and I'm sure 
we can help you out.
